Most brands clear the first two, feel finished, and get caught at a gate they did not know existed. Here is the full sequence, and the point in each where a foreign-owned brand tends to fail without noticing.
Get structured correctly
The entity, the ownership, and the tax certification have to agree with each other before you ever apply. The US representative role is one checkpoint inside this gate, not the whole picture. Get this wrong and every gate after it inherits the error.
Pass verification
Identity, documents, and addresses have to line up exactly. A mismatch a human would forgive, the system rejects. This is the gate everyone focuses on, and it is only the second of five.
Become operational
Approved is not the same as paid. Banking, payouts, and the tax interview each test the structure again. A shop that verified cleanly can still stall here, holding revenue it cannot release.
Progress through probation
A new shop operates under closer watch. What you do, and do not do, in this early window shapes how the account is treated for a long time after.
Remain compliant as you scale and face future reviews
Re-verification and periodic reviews are not one-time events. The structure that passed at launch has to keep passing as the rules change and your volume grows. This is where a defect from Gate 1 finally comes due.
